The Power of Daily Habits
Whether it’s setting goals, managing time effectively, or practicing self-discipline, successful people recognize the power of consistency. They know that every small step contributes to larger achievements. As Aristotle said, “We are what we repeatedly do. Excellence, then, is not an act, but a habit.”
“The successful warrior is the average man, with laser-like focus.” — Bruce Lee
Staying Motivated Through Discipline
Motivation comes and goes, but discipline is what keeps successful people on track. Cultivating habits like morning routines, exercise, and reflection allows them to stay aligned with their goals.
“Discipline is the bridge between goals and accomplishment.” — Jim Rohn
“The habit of persistence is the habit of victory.” — Herbert Kaufman

Tips for Building Successful Habits
Each of these habits nurtures a mindset and lifestyle that contribute to long-term success, both personally and professionally. Adopting new habits doesn’t happen overnight. Here are some tips for cultivating the habits of successful people:
- Start Small
Focus on one habit at a time, like setting a daily goal or reflecting each evening. - Be Consistent
Consistency is key. Small actions done repeatedly become part of your routine. - Seek Accountability
Find a friend, mentor, or accountability partner to keep you on track. - Celebrate Progress
Recognize and reward yourself for each milestone. - Prioritize Consistency Over Perfection
Small, steady steps every day matter more than aiming for perfection. Consistency builds habits that last, while perfection can lead to burnout. - Practice Accountability
Hold yourself accountable by tracking your progress. Whether through journaling or a digital tool, tracking keeps you grounded and committed. - Break Goals into Small Actions
Big goals can feel overwhelming, but when you break them into smaller, manageable steps, it’s easier to make consistent progress. - Learn to Manage Time Wisely
Successful people know that time is a limited resource. Use techniques like time-blocking to focus on tasks that align with your goals. - Nurture a Growth Mindset
Embrace challenges as learning opportunities. A growth mindset allows you to see setbacks as lessons and encourages lifelong learning. - Build a Routine That Suits You
A well-structured routine helps maintain focus and reduces decision fatigue. Choose activities and timing that align with your natural energy levels. - Limit Multitasking
Concentrate on one task at a time to increase productivity and improve the quality of your work. Multitasking often leads to errors and distractions. - Prioritize Self-Care
Taking care of your physical and mental health enables sustained focus and resilience. Daily self-care practices can prevent burnout and boost motivation. - Learn to Say ‘No’
Protect your time and energy by setting boundaries. Saying “no” allows you to focus on what truly matters, helping you reach your goals more effectively. - Embrace Failures as Feedback
Instead of fearing failure, view it as valuable feedback. Analyze what went wrong and adjust your approach to keep moving forward. - Practice Gratitude Daily
Recognizing what you’re thankful for fosters a positive outlook, which enhances resilience and helps you stay motivated, especially during tough times. - Surround Yourself with Supportive People
The company you keep influences your mindset. Seek out people who inspire and support your ambitions, creating an environment that uplifts you. - Dedicate Time for Learning
Schedule regular learning sessions to acquire new skills or knowledge. Constant learning keeps you adaptable and sharp in an ever-evolving world. - Visualize Your Success
Visualization is a powerful tool for motivation. Picture your success in vivid detail to reinforce why you’re working hard and to keep your goals top of mind. - Celebrate Small Wins
Acknowledge every step forward, no matter how minor. Celebrating progress builds momentum and keeps your morale high on the journey. - Practice Empathy and Kindness
A successful life isn’t just about reaching personal goals but also contributing positively to others. Compassion fosters meaningful relationships, which enrich your journey.
